Enhancing promotion and market connectivity for rural industrial goods
The 2025 Rural Industrial Products Exhibition and Fair, held in Hanoi from October 3 to 7, has attracted the participation of rural industrial enterprises nationwide. As an annual event hosted by the Ministry of Industry and Trade, the fair not only serves as a key platform to promote rural industrial products but also creates opportunities for enterprises to connect, cooperate, and form production and business supply chains.
Assessing the significance of the event, Deputy Minister of Industry and Trade Phan Thi Thang emphasized that the exhibition serves as an effective bridge, generating economic value and creating practical opportunities for enterprises to seek investment partnerships, expand markets, enhance competitiveness, and strengthen their brand presence both domestically and internationally.

Recognizing the pivotal role of rural industrial enterprises and production facilities in local socio-economic development, the Government has authorized the Ministry of Industry and Trade and provincial People’s Committees to implement a wide range of industrial promotion policies. These have proven effective in accompanying and assisting enterprises in expanding production and improving business performance.
According to Deputy Minister Thang, among the various components of industrial promotion, the recognition of exemplary rural industrial products and the implementation of trade promotion programs remain key annual priorities nationwide. These activities affirm the importance of industrial promotion as a vital mechanism that enables enterprises to increase production capacity, improve product quality, stimulate trade, and contribute to overall economic growth.
Over the past decade, more than 4,200 exemplary rural industrial products have been certified across all levels, including 800 at the national level. Through industrial promotion programs, over 80% of these recognized products have received support for technological innovation, advanced machinery application, technical demonstration models, and trade promotion.
“More than 70% of these products have now entered distribution channels and supply chains nationwide,” Deputy Minister Phan Thi Thang noted.
Enterprises seek continued support for market expansion
At the exhibition, Nguyen Xuan Tung, Deputy Director of Binh Lieu Trading and Services JSC, shared that Binh Lieu vermicelli, a traditional specialty of Quang Ninh Province, has received multiple recognitions as an exemplary rural industrial product.
He said the company currently distributes mainly through traditional channels such as food stores and supermarket chains, while online sales via platforms like Lazada, Shopee, and TikTok account for only about 10% of total sales.
“Although vermicelli is widely produced in many provinces, Binh Lieu vermicelli continues to perform well, with steady annual growth,” Nguyen Xuan Tung said. “We maintain our signature small, soft, and chewy noodles suited to Vietnamese family meals, while also developing new products such as black tea vermicelli that combine traditional features with innovative flavors.”
The company aims to expand exports to China, a large but demanding market with strong consumer demand for vermicelli products. “We hope to receive further support from the Ministry of Industry and Trade in export promotion, particularly to the Chinese market, which offers significant potential given the geographical proximity and shared culinary culture,” Nguyen Xuan Tung added.
Another major brand, Khai Hoan Phu Quoc Fish Sauce Company from An Giang Province, which has also received multiple rural industrial product recognitions, expressed concern about the limited domestic market share of traditional fish sauce.
According to Nguyen Van Cuong, Sales Manager at the company, many consumers still confuse fish sauce with dipping sauce, though they are entirely different products. “People often assume fish sauce, made from fish and salt, is overly salty. In reality, with modern production techniques, the salt content has been refined while preserving the authentic flavor”, Nguyen Van Cuong explained.

He noted that as consumers increasingly prioritize safe, health-conscious food, demand for traditional fish sauce has been growing, particularly among urban and middle-income groups. However, awareness in rural areas remains limited.
To expand its reach, the company has been diversifying its distribution channels, including supermarkets, clean food stores, minimarts, wholesale and retail systems, and e-commerce platforms such as Shopee and Facebook. “Although online sales remain modest, they represent a promising avenue for growth,” Nguyen Van Cuong said. The company also continues to export its products to the United States and Europe.
“For Khai Hoan and traditional fish sauce producers in general to secure a firm foothold in the domestic market, we hope to receive continued support to participate in trade promotion programs both at home and abroad,” Nguyen Van Cuong said.
Expanding and strengthening market presence remains a challenging task for rural industrial products. Through a variety of targeted programs, the Ministry of Industry and Trade has provided effective support for enterprises in both production development and market expansion.
Deputy Minister Phan Thi Thang emphasized that to fully realize these outcomes, enterprises must continue to focus on maintaining product development while ensuring compliance with market, technical, aesthetic, cultural, and environmental standards. She also called on enterprises to take advantage of Vietnam’s free trade agreements, diversify their products, and participate more deeply in global supply chains, enhancing competitiveness and sustaining long-term growth.
